Bill Putnam

Oct. 26, 1935-Nov. 18, 2020

Charles William (Bill)

Putnam, 85, Minot, form-

erly of the Grand Forks &

Alsen area, ND, died

Wednesday, November

18, 2020 in a Minot Nurs-

ing Home.

Bill was born October

26, 1935 at Grand Forks,

North Dakota, the son of

Charles and Louise

(Rund) Putnam. He was

raised in Grand Forks,

ND, Proctor, MN and

Seattle, WA. He later

moved to Alsen, ND,

where he lived with his

Aunt Molly and Uncle

Jake Albrecht and gra-

duated from high school

in 1954.

Bill was united in mar-

riage to his high school

sweetheart, Melva Pan-

kratz, July 28, 1953 in Al-

sen. Bill was employed

with Red Owl Grocery

throughout North Dakota

and Minnesota. The fami-

ly moved to Minot in 1971

where he worked for I.

Keating Furniture. He

would later become the

pastor of the Calvary Alli-

ance Church in Minot.

In 1980, he and Melva

would begin a traveling

ministry of music and

evangelism through the

Christian Missionary Alli-

ance denomination,

where they traveled ex-

tensively across the US

and Canada. Following

this, he entered into min-

istry as full time Pastor at

Polson, Montana for 16

years with the Christian

Missionary Alliance

Church. During this time,

he completed studies and

became an ordained min-

ister.

He retired to North

Dakota to be nearer his

family. He was a former

member of the Swiss

Mennonite Church in Al-

sen and had attended

First Assembly of God

Church in Minot. He was

a member of the XYZ fel-

lowship at First Baptist

Church, the Sertoma Club

of Minot and had enjoyed

playing the guitar, hunt-

ing and fishing.
